Why Meatloaf is a Timeless Comfort Food

Meatloaf has a fascinating history that dates back centuries. Though it’s now a household favorite in the United States, its origins can be traced to medieval Europe, where minced meat was combined with spices and baked into a loaf. However, it wasn’t until the Great Depression that meatloaf became a staple in American homes. Families needed to stretch their food budgets, and adding breadcrumbs, eggs, and seasonings to ground meat was a cost-effective solution.

Today, meatloaf continues to be one of the most popular home-cooked meals. According to Smithsonian Magazine, this dish has evolved with different regional flavors, making it a versatile comfort food enjoyed nationwide.

3. Meat Thermometer

A meat thermometer is essential for ensuring your meatloaf is cooked to perfection. According to USDA guidelines, ground beef should reach an internal temperature of 160°F, while ground poultry needs to be 165°F.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What’s the secret to a juicy meatloaf?

The key is using a good balance of fat (80/20 ground beef), breadcrumbs soaked in milk, and eggs to keep it moist. Also, don’t overmix the meat!

2. Why does my meatloaf fall apart?

If your meatloaf is crumbling, it may need more binding ingredients, like eggs and breadcrumbs. Letting it rest after baking also helps it hold its shape.

3. Can I make meatloaf ahead of time?

Yes! Prepare and shape the meatloaf, then store it covered in the fridge for up to 24 hours before baking.

4. Can I cook meatloaf in an air fryer?

Absolutely! Air fryer meatloaf cooks faster and develops a crispier crust. Just shape the loaf to fit your air fryer basket and cook at 350°F for 25-30 minutes.

5. How do I make gluten-free meatloaf?

Replace breadcrumbs with almond flour, crushed pork rinds, or gluten-free oats for a gluten-free version.
